New Hampshire, AKA- the Granite State, is where I am from. Our motto is "Live free or die." We strive to make our country proud. We aren't just another bunch of nothern hics or Yankees. That's not what we are all about. We are about fresh country air, calm woods, long dirt roads, snowy winters, and colorful autumns.. Our beauty lies in our people as well as in our scenery. We are looked at as one of the most superb states as far as our natural  beauty goes.  We have a whopping 4,000 lakes and ponds in NH and each one glistens with pride. We have places that are simply ravishing, such as Nash Stream. The mountains are great for hiking and can take your breath away. Now enough of me talking lets see some of that scenic beauty.
